Client Servicing AdministratorLocation: London/HybridSalary: Up to £38,000, depending on experience + excellent benefit package
Are you an enthusiastic Client Servicing Administrator who could fulfil a vital support function within a busy Financial Services and Wealth Management office?You will be working as part of the team at a highly respected Partner Practice of St. James’s Place Plc who provide bespoke financial advice and services to a broad range of clients, individuals, high net worth individuals, families and businesses. The Role: Client Servicing Administrator duties include:
- Being responsible for liaising with third party providers to gather information for both Planners so that they can provide holistic financial planning solutions to their clients.
- Building strong relationships with all clients and key stakeholders by being the first point of contact for all aspects of client administration and dealing with technical admin queries
- Managing client records for the Financial Advisers via the CRM software, Salesforce, ensuring that the necessary information is captured and kept up to date on a daily basis.
- Being the key relationship manager with main stakeholders including admin centres
- Processing client withdrawals and redemptions.
- Processing submissions and new client money including liaising with clients regarding bank details and timescales.
- Processing client portfolio changes and rebalancing.
- Processing ongoing advice documentation for client financial reviews.
- Processing client capital gain disposals.
- Client onboarding administration.
- Reporting to the Planners on a daily basis.
The Person: Client Servicing Administrator will have the following qualities:
- Preferably 2 years + experience in a client servicing support role within a St. James's Place Partner Practice.
- Excellent customer service and the ability to build rapport and manage client relationships
- Strong attention to detail and be able to problem solve and think on your feet
- Good time management and planning skills
- Strong working knowledge of Excel, Word, and other Microsoft Office Programs
- It is essential that you are confident in dealing with colleagues, third parties and can work with total discretion
